本篇文章给大家谈谈c语言的structure,以及C语言的关键字是什么对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
c语言结构体
1、在C语言中,定义结构体可以使用struct关键字。结构体是一种自定义的数据类型,可以包含多个不同类型的成员变量。
2、C语言结构体定义:struct为结构体关键字,tag为结构体的标志,member-list为结构体成员列表,其必须列出其所有成员;variable-list为此结构体声明的变量。结构体是C语言中聚合数据类型(aggregatedatatype)的一类。
3、结构体c语言也就是C语言结构体,C语言结构体(Struct)从本质上讲是一种自定义的数据类型,只不过这种数据类型比较复杂,是由 int、char、float 等基本类型组成的,可以认为结构体是一种聚合类型。
c语言结构体定义和使用是什么?
1、在C语言中,可以使用结构体(Struct)来存放一组不同类型的数据。
2、定义如下,A是结构体名称,C语言中使用方式:struct A m,使用方式:A、m。定义如下,A是结构体名称,使用方式和1中一样,不同的是,在定义的时候还定义了一个变量m,可以直接使用变量m。
3、c语言结构体是类似于名片形式的数据集合体,可以把它理解为一种由用户自定义的特殊的复合型的“数据类型”,在这个复合型的“数据类型”中可以包含多种基本数据类型,我们可以把它作为一个整体来操作。
C语言编程struct函数的使用,放100个学生的数据、包括学号、姓名、成绩...
B:struct student stu[100]{...中stu[100]写在这里不合法,错误;所以是正确选项。C:属于无名结构体,它必须同时声明变量,这里声明的是stu[100],数组也是合法的,正确。
在C语言中,可以使用结构体(Struct)来存放一组不同类型的数据。
C++中的struct和class一样可以有成员函数(上面代码中的 void show是成员函数;Student(char *name, char *id, int grade)是一个特殊的成员函数,叫构造函数,该函数用于实例化一个类的对象)。
struct stu data[N];readrec(data,N);writerec(data,N);return 0;} 程序如上,是读入2名学生的,为了截图方便,你如果想读入5名。把 define N 2 改为 define N 5 就可以了。是C语言实现的。
关于c语言的structure和C语言的关键字是什么的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。